difference between Depart and Deport?
What is the difference between Depart and Deport? :
Depart : (verb)
(
1 ) Leave
Go away
They departed for madras at 11 A.M.
(
2 ) Behave in a way that differs from what is usual or expected
Do not depart from the truth.
Deport : (verb)
(
1 ) Legally force an unwanted person to leave a country
